NXP Semiconductors NXP CLRC663 Plus NFC前端

NXP Semiconductor CLRC663+是一款高性能多协议NFC前端,完全符合射频标准。 CLRC663+的电源电压低至2.5V,可以提高电池供电系统的效率。CLRC663+的扩展温度范围为-40°C至+105°C,非常适合用于需要在严苛条件下或工业环境中运行的应用。 CLRC663+的最大工作变送器电流为350mA,限制值为500mA。高电流通过补偿射频场中的损耗(例如由附近存在的金属产生的损耗)来提高性能。 CLRC663+的其他可提高性能以及灵活性的特性包括:支持ISO/IEC 15693 NFC Forum T5T读取、对MIFARE® (Crypto 1) 的综合支持,以及用于过冲保护的高级波形控制。 因为采用带可湿性侧翼的紧凑型HVQFN32 (5mm x 5mm x 0.85mm) 封装,所以更易查看CLRC663+的封装是否成功焊接到PCB上,因此,装配后期的检查变得更加简单、快速、高效。

特性

  • High performance and more flexible antenna design
    • Maximum transmitter current: 350mA operating with 500mA limiting value
    • Freely programmable 6kByte EEPROM
  • Long battery life
    • 2.5V to 5.5V supply voltage
    • Hard power-down, standby, and extended LPCD options power-save modes
  • Industrial/Automotive
    • -40°C to 105°C temp range
  • Multiple interfaces to support a broad range of microcontrollers and high-security reader implementations
    • SPI, I2C, and UART host interfaces
    • Up to 8 GPIO
    • SAM interface
    • 512-byte FIFO buffer reduces performance requirements of a host controller
  • Fast development
    • Supports NFC Cockpit and NFC Reader Library
    • Complete development kits available
  • Includes NXP ISO/IEC14443-A and Innovatron ISO/IEC14443-B intellectual property licensing rights
  • EMVCo ready
    • EMVCo 2.6 L1 analog and digital compliance
  • Full RF standard compliance
    • ISO/IEC 14443A/MIFARE
    • ISO/IEC 14443B
    • JIS X 6319-4 (comparable with FeliCa1 scheme)
    • ISO/IEC 15693 (ICODE® SLIX family, ICODE DNA)
    • ISO/IEC 18000-3 mode 3/ EPC Class-1 HF (ICODE ILT family)
    • Peer-to-Peer Mode: ISO/IEC 18092 passive initiator
  • Compatible with all NXP smartcard products
    • Complete MIFARE family: Ultralight, Classic 1K, Classic 4K, DESFire EV1, DESfire EV2, and Plus EV1
    • Complete NTAG® family including NTAG I2C plus
    • Complete SmartMX® family including SmartMX2 P40 and SmartMX2 P60
  • Compact, time-saving package
    • HVQFN32 with wettable flanks to support high production yield
    • Pin-compatible to CLRC663 makes it easy to upgrade from existing designs
